[Product Review/Swatches] Coastal Scents Forever Blush - all 18 shades (Long Post - Image Heavy)


So during their Black Friday 50% off sale, I went ahead and purchased their Forever Blush set that contains all 18 shades for $59.98 (normally $119.95). Through that deal, each blush only cost about $3.33. A single blush costs $7.95 so if you really can't decide which shade to get and want them all, it's still a better deal to buy the set than to buy individually.

[Product Review/Swatches] Coastal Scents Revealed Palette

Another purchase I made during Black Friday was with Coastal Scents. Coastal Scents is a really well-known online makeup supply among beauty bloggers. As I kept seeing their products featured in tutorials, I really wanted to try some for myself.

Coastal Scents released a 20 eye shadow palette that can be a dupe for Urban Decay's Naked and Naked 2 palettes. It has a much more economical price comparatively. Urban Decay Naked palettes cost $52 each with 10 eye shadows while this palette cost $19.95.
